1. These two writ petitions have been filed by one and the same petitioner. In the first one, the petitioner has challenged Government order No. 26-Edu of 2016 dated 02.02.2016 whereby the Government in the School Education Department, on a review of attachments/deployment of staff in the School Education Department, inter alia, ordered repatriation of the officers/officials working in the Project Directorate of SSA over and above its sanctioned strength. The petitioner has prayed that respondents, more particularly respondent No. 3 (Project Director, SSA, J&K at Jammu), be prohibited from acting on the aforesaid Government order and be directed to allow the petitioner to continue in his department as per order dated 21.07.2014. In the second writ petition, the petitioner has challenged order No. 123/DSEK of 2016 dated 03.02.2016 issued by respondent No. 2, the Director, School Education, so far as it pertains to him, with further prayers almost identical to the ones made in the first writ petition.
